If a muslim knows and is sure that this meat is from an animal which is permissible for muslims to eat like cow, sheep or chicken but that it is not slaughtered in accordance with islamic laws, that meat is to be considered mayta. Islamic dietary guidelines by islamic law, all foods are considered halal, or lawful, except for pork and its byproducts, animals improperly slaughtered or dead before slaughtering, animals slaughtered in the name of anyone but allah god, carnivorous animals, birds of prey, animals without external ears some birds and reptiles, blood.
